About the artwork: Sir Henry Raeburn, renowned for his realistic and intimate approach, excels in the art of capturing the essence of his subjects. In this art print, Scott-Elliot’s piercing gaze and his posture, both relaxed and confident, demonstrate Raeburn’s mastery. The meticulous details, such as the folds of the shirt and the subtle skin tones, reveal a concern for realism that was revolutionary for the era.
Artistic context: Raeburn marked the early 19th century with portraits full of psychological depth. At a time when portraiture was a means to assert social status, Raeburn succeeded in transcending this function by infusing a human and introspective dimension into his works.
